The “Wallace” is a aircraft made by NJB Corp. for the Krakabloan-Wright Air Force based off of the earlier N-65D-4 “Frogmouth” and has been changed into a heavy close air support and COIN aircraft. The Wallace is capable of VTOL and has variable geometry wings, but because of the much lower speed than the original Frogmouth the wings only sweep back 25 degrees. The Wallace was also given a much more advanced cockpit with more options and better avionics. With the role switch from a high speed interceptor to a low speed ground attack aircraft, the airframe itself has to be changed, the major changes were the installation of armor plating around the pilot and on the underside of the aircrafts around the fuel and engine along with the radar being removed to let the nose slope down harder and give the pilot better visibility. The decision was also made to add on specially made pylons on the wing to allow ordnance or drop tanks to be fitted under the wings, and because of its ability to move with the wings and stay straight, they are permanent.

Side notes —
The Wallace is very hard to control when trying to land in VTOL, and it is suggested that you jettison all ground munitions before you start the landing procedure, since the engines and underpowered and respond very slowly to power increase and decrease. The emergency drogue chute is to be used when one or both of the lift engines are damaged and there is no proper runway to land on or the aircraft is going too quickly. Other than that, the aircraft has a mostly working cockpit , good visibility, and is able to take out most ground and naval units on the map without rearm or refuel.

Also, the name “Wallace” comes from the Wallace Flying Frog, and was just shorted to Wallace for simplicity.
